Celtic fans are unhappy former boss Brendan Rodgers is loaning a player to Rangers.

Celtic fans have been expressing their disappointment at ex-manager Brendan Rodgers.
Rodgers is said to have given the green light for Leicester veteran Andy King to join Celtic’s bitter rivals Rangers on loan.
The Scottish Sun report King, 30, is set to seal a season long loan deal to Rangers.
Rodgers managed Celtic for nearly three seasons, before quitting suddenly in February to take the vacant Leicester job.
Some Celtic fans had at least hoped that Rodgers may throw his former side a bone or two in the transfer market this summer, but there have been no dealings between the two clubs.
Now his approval for a deal for a player to join rivals Rangers has not gone down well at all.
